CINCINNATI, Ohio – Friday night, the visiting Wheeling Nailers defeated the Cincinnati Cyclones 4-3 in overtime. Tristan Ashbrook scored a hat trick, but it wasn’t enough to beat the second-place Nailers. Matt Koopman scored the winning goal 48 seconds into OT.
